First off, a trip to Queenstown. Jeannine's parents had been here
before--roughly 18 years ago. However, Queenstown looked
nothing to them like it had earlier. If only they had bought
property then! A tiny two bedroom house will now fetch about
$300,000 US. The place has become the main tourist hub
overnight--and with views and skiing to suit, it's not hard to
see why.

Not to let Dave and Julie get away with just watching, we
convinced them to do something a little wild as well. First
though, to the historic town of Arrowtown we headed. Situated
about 20 minutes outside Q-town, this place rose up out of the
discovery and hence, rush of alluvial gold in the Arrow River.
Today, it looks much the same as it did 100 years ago--but
with tourist shops replacing the saloons. Dave and I took to
gold panning in the river--we ended up cleaning some rocks.
Apparently though, some nut had found $2,000.00 worth a mile
up stream the previous week. We detested him. After meeting up

After Queenstown, we took off to the town of Tehanu to rest
before heading to the Fiordlands. The next morning, a boat
picked us up at the entrance to Manapouri Lake and we cruised
towards Doubtful Sound. This place is simply to amazing to
describe. Untouched, raw nature that is the same today as it
was thousands of years ago. New Zealand has gone a long way in
protecting it's greatest gems and over 30% of the country is
composed of National Parks. The Fiordlands have been declared
a World Heritage Site and they're more than worthy of the
title. Gorgeous mountains rise high above the sounds filled
with beautiful trees, song birds, and waterfalls. It rains
nearly all the time there, but we were lucky to get a perfect
day.
